Keeping Things Below: Why It Matters

You might ask, why should I bother about the position of the chest tube? Well, think of the chest tube as a crucial highway for air and fluid to traverse out of the thoracic cavity. When it's positioned correctly, it supports effective drainage, promoting optimal lung function and helping your patient on their road to recovery.

If the system is above the level of the chest, you run the risk of backflow, potentially allowing fluid or air to seep back into the pleural space. No one wants that, right? This can lead to serious complications like pneumothorax (a collapsed lung) or pleural effusion (fluid accumulation). So, ensuring the system’s proper position isn’t just a suggestion; it’s a lifesaving measure.
